package kubernetes
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"os"
"github.com/spf13/cobra"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/gql"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/appconfig"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/command"
extensions_core "github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/command/extensions/core"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/command/orgs"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/flag"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/internal/flyutil"
"github.com/superfly/flyctl/iostreams"
)
const (
betaMsg = "Fly Kubernetes is in beta, it is not recommended for critical production use cases. For help or feedback, email us at beta@fly.io"
)
func create() (cmd *cobra.Command) {
const (
short = "Provision a Kubernetes cluster for an organization"
long = short + "\n"
usage = "create [flags]"
)
cmd = command.New(usage, short, long, runK8sCreate, command.RequireSession)
flag.Add(cmd,
flag.String{
Name: "name",
Shorthand: "n",
Description: "The name of your cluster",
},
flag.Org(),
flag.Region(),
flag.String{
Name: "output",
Description: "The output path to save the kubeconfig file",
},
)
return cmd
}
func runK8sCreate(ctx context.Context) (err error) {
io := iostreams.FromContext(ctx)
colorize := io.ColorScheme()
fmt.Fprintln(io.Out, colorize.Yellow(betaMsg))
client := flyutil.ClientFromContext(ctx).GenqClient()
appName := appconfig.NameFromContext(ctx)
targetOrg, err := orgs.OrgFromFlagOrSelect(ctx)
if err != nil {
return err
}
extension, err := extensions_core.ProvisionExtension(ctx, extensions_core.ExtensionParams{
AppName: appName,
Provider: "kubernetes",
Organization: targetOrg,
})
if err != nil {
return err
}
resp, err := gql.GetAddOn(ctx, client, extension.Data.Name, string(gql.AddOnTypeKubernetes))
if err != nil {
return err
}
outFilename := flag.GetString(ctx, "output")
if outFilename == "" {
outFilename = fmt.Sprintf("%s.kubeconfig.yml", resp.AddOn.Name)
}
f, err := os.Create(outFilename)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er f.Close()
metadata := resp.AddOn.Metadata.(map[string]interface{})
kubeconfig := metadata["kubeconfig"].(string)
if _, err := f.Write([]byte(kubeconfig));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to write kubeconfig to file %s, error: %w", outFilename, err)
}
fmt.Fprintf(io.Out, "Wrote kubeconfig to file %s. Use it to connect to your cluster", outFilename)
return
}
